navicat16的3780错误
时间: 2024-08-27 13:04:00 浏览: 88
Navicat 16 中的 3780 错误通常表示数据库连接问题。这个特定的错误码可能不是标准错误代码,而是 Navicat 自定义的。3780错误可能是由于以下几个原因导致的:
1. **权限问题**:用户账户可能没有足够的权限访问指定的数据库服务器或数据库。
2. **网络连接**:服务器未响应或网络中断,导致连接失败。
3. **防火墙阻止**:防火墙设置可能阻止了Navicat的连接请求。
4. **数据库服务已关闭**:如果数据库服务未运行,Navicat将无法建立连接。
5. **认证信息错误**:用户名、密码或两者输入有误。
要解决这个问题,你可以尝试以下步骤:
- 检查并确认你的登录凭据是否有效。
- 确保数据库服务器正在运行并且网络连接正常。
- 检查防火墙设置是否有对Navicat的连接开放。
- 如果是企业环境,确保账号有足够的操作权限。
- 更新或重新安装Navicat到最新版本,有时候软件更新可以修复一些错误。
相关问题
navicat1292错误
Navicat 是一款常用的数据库管理工具,遇到 "Navicat1292" 错误通常是指在与 MySQL 数据库交互时遇到了某种编码或字符集相关的错误。这个错误编号并不固定,可能是由于以下原因:
1. 字符集不匹配:如果 Navicat 和数据库之间的字符集设置不一致,比如 Navicat 使用的是 UTF-8,而数据库默认的是其他字符集,可能会导致此错误。
2. SQL 语句包含非支持字符:如果查询字符串中包含了 Navicat 所使用的字符集不支持的特殊字符,可能导致解析失败。
3. 数据库连接参数问题:检查连接配置,包括主机名、端口、用户名和密码是否正确,以及连接属性(如字符集设置)是否合适。
4. 版本兼容性问题:有时 Navicat 的某个版本可能存在与 MySQL 服务器的兼容性问题。
解决这个问题的一般步骤包括:
- 检查并确认 Navicat 和数据库的字符集设置是否一致。
- 确保输入的 SQL 语句正确无误。
- 更新或调整连接参数。
- 如果问题依然存在,尝试更新到 Navicat 的最新版本,或者降级 MySQL 服务器到与 Navicat 较为兼容的版本。
navicat连接mysql错误
Navicat是一款常用的数据库管理工具,它可以连接多种类型的数据库,包括MySQL。在连接MySQL时,可能会遇到一些错误,如下:
1. 连接超时:可能是由于网络原因导致连接时间过长,可以尝试增加连接超时时间或检查网络连接。
2. 认证失败:可能是由于用户名或密码错误导致的,需要检查用户名和密码是否正确。
3. 无法连接到MySQL服务器:可能是由于MySQL服务器未启动或防火墙设置了限制导致的,需要检查MySQL服务是否启动并检查防火墙设置。
4. 数据库不存在:可能是由于指定的数据库名称错误或该数据库不存在导致的,需要检查数据库名称是否正确或创建该数据库。
如果遇到以上问题仍无法解决,请在具体报错信息上进行详细排查。
阅读全文